Summary: This is the perfect time of year for a trip out to the Grassy Waters Preserve. This 23 square mile wetlands ecosystem that serves as the freshwater supply for the City of West Palm Beach and the towns of South Palm Beach and Palm Beach Island. Kravis Mozarteum Orchestra
of Salzburg
The Mozarteum can trace its origins to an ensemble founded in 1841 with support from Mozart’s widow, Constanze. This season, the orchestra and Vlatkovic, one of the world’s most exceptional horn players, will make their Regional Arts debut.
